The 904 evolved into the 500 which was later renamed the 42RH. The 727->518->46RH. 1996+ went to the RE models which are useless to you so make sure you don't get one of those.

I have read others who went to the GM 4 speed autos for better/cheaper aftermarket support and a smaller physical size to not have to cut.


One day when I get off of my ass, I want to get one of those A41 4 speed kits from Silver Sport. They are based on the GM 700R4.


Personally I prefer the driveability of a 200R4 over a 700R4 all day long, especially in a DD with a tight converter. The big 1-2 ratio drop on the 700R4 really can lug the motor down. I guess it depends on how picky you are on that sort of thing. And fitment is also usually better on the 200R4.
